Analyzes applicants financial status, credit, and property evaluations to determine feasibility of granting loans.
Obtains and compiles copies of loan applicants credit histories, corporate financial statements, and other financial information.
Explains to customers the different types of loans and credit options that are available, as well as the terms of those services.
Reviews loan agreements to ensure that they are complete and accurate according to company policy, guidelines, compliance, and lending regulations.
Maintains customer confidence by keeping all loan information confidential.
Maintains licenses and compliance by participating in required continuing education courses.
Works as a team with sales, processing, underwriting, closing, post-closing and management to ensure the customer receives excellent service.
Originates your own sales by contacting prospective clients and developing and monitoring referral sources.
Meeting clients outside of the employers place of business in order to initiate sales.
Spends a significant amount of time away from their employers place of business meeting with prospective customers at locations other than the employers business, such as a clients home, and making in-person calls on real estate agents and brokers, financial advisors and other potential referral sources.
